Sarah Rees
Sarah Elizabeth Rees (born 1957) is Professor of Pure Mathematics at Newcastle University. Her focus of research is on geometrical, combinatorial and computational aspects of group theory.Rees obtained her Ph.D. in 1983 from the University of Oxford. Her dissertation, supervised by Peter Cameron, was ''On Diagram Geometry''.
In 2003, Rees was a member of the expert panel for BBC Radio 4's ''In Our Time'' on infinity.
Rees is the daughter of mathematician David Rees. Provided by Wikipedia
